Jack Kehl then discussed H.B. 208 being eliminated and a new substitute bill is being introduced. These House Bills are dealing with retainage with subcontractors. The passage of this bill will allow subcontractors to be able to get their retainage upon completion of their portion of work rather than wait until the entire project is completed.
